I would call and ask her what she needs. If nothing, fancy boxed chocolates or a batch of nice Christmas cookies, assuming you're a decent baker. She could put either of those things out with dessert, or interpret it as a hostess gift if she has dessert specifically planned out.
A whimsical package of Christmas cocktail napkins would be a fun add-on. Consumables are always appreciated in our household. |
